David Levermore is a professor of mathematics at the University of Maryland whose landmark analysis of the small-dispersion limit of the Korteweg—de Vries equation — conducted in collaboration with Peter Lax — helped establish the mathematical theory of dispersive shock waves. Levermore earned his undergraduate degree at Clarkson College and his doctorate in analysis and nonlinear wave propagation from New York University’s Courant Institute in 1982, where his dissertation examined the small-dispersion limit of the KdV equation. His three-part paper series with Lax, published in Communications on Pure and Applied Mathematics in 1983, became a foundational reference for the zero-dispersion theory and has been cited hundreds of times. At the University of Maryland, where he is a professor of mathematics affiliated with the Institute for Physical Science and Technology, he has extended his work to kinetic theory, Boltzmann equations, hydrodynamic limits, shallow water systems, and the derivation of fluid dynamical systems from kinetic theories. He has served as a vice president for science policy of the Society for Industrial and Applied Mathematics (SIAM).
